Fig 1 This graph shows program specific overall discharge mortality plotted against program specific mean basic complexity score plotted by annual volume of cases for the 54 participating EACTS sites. Center annual volume is depicted as the size of the bubble. Fig 2 This graph shows program specific overall discharge mortality plotted against program specific mean basic complexity score plotted by annual volume of cases for the 21 participating Society of Thoracic Surgeons sites with greater than or equal to 94% complete discharge mortality data. Center annual volume is depicted as the size of the circle.
